Online Registration Systems- Dance competitions now can use Online Registration Systems that are built into their websites. These systems allow for studios to create an online profile. These profiles will contain all the studio information and all the dancers, teachers, choreographers at that studio. The studio can then; register students for different battles locations, register the desired routines for the students and then pay instantly online. The whole process has gone from potentially taking weeks to minutes.

Excel has been a great support for battles when scheduling but when you have hundreds of routines to schedule, and you have to manually make sure there are no dancers going back to back, all the times are correct, and things are exactly perfect it can all add up to one big nightmare. There are now Automated Scheduling plus Tabulation Systems available for dance battles. These systems synchronize with the current Online Registration System that the battle is using to retrieve all; registration, location, and studio information.

Dancing battles are now able to shoot high quality footage of their battle and routines which can be sorted and organized by routine and uploaded to the battles website. No more DVDs and outdated VHS tapes. All the video from a battle along with audio from the judges will become available from their own website with the ability to sell or give away as the battle sees fit.
